Abstract

Recent advancements in Artificial Intelligence (AI) have led to the emergence of AI Agents, autonomous systems performing complex tasks and pursuing defined objectives with minimal human interaction. Early research in AI Agents in supply chain (SC) management is pointing to their potential for enhancing visibility, resilience, and operational efficiency. However, as AI Agents are an emerging technology, several aspects of their application remain unclear. The literature lacks understanding of the SC processes they can support, the main drivers and constraints influencing their adoption, and practitioners’ perspectives on these aspects. Moreover, as their implementation inevitably reshapes human actors’ roles, scholars have called for further investigation into the nature of agent interaction with humans. This exploratory qualitative study addresses these gaps through semi-structured interviews with experienced practitioners in AI and SC. To the best of the authors’ knowledge, this is among the first studies to jointly address, through an integrated framework, the mapping of SC processes that AI Agents can support, the associated drivers and constraints to adoption ranked according to SC practitioners, and the human-AI Agent collaboration roles for each category of processes. The study reveals novel AI Agent-specific elements and introduces a conceptual framework alongside four testable propositions.
